Rf Engineer

3 days p/w onsite

Can be based from Edinburgh, Newcastle, Bristol, Luton or Southampton

Our client, a leading organisation in the Defence & Security sector, is currently seeking an experienced RF Engineer to join their team on a contract basis. This is an exciting opportunity to work at the forefront of defence technology, developing cutting-edge radars for advanced fighter jets and innovative maritime and airborne surveillance systems. You will have the chance to bring your expertise into a dynamic work environment, contributing to the development of multifunctional RF, PCB, and Module designs using the latest technologies.

Key Responsibilities:

Managing the full Rf lifecycle, from system concept through detailed design, prototyping, testing, and verification, to system integration and production support.
Creating high-quality and robust designs, conducting design reviews, fully documenting and recording work products, and keeping them under configuration management.
Designing multifunctional RF PCB and Module designs, enhancing your understanding of key design and manufacturing processes.
Developing test prototypes for design validation and verification of development models, and supporting production tests.
Carrying out detailed design activities from requirements capture to design verification.
Ensuring successful completion of design reviews.
Preparing robust manufacturing data packs and providing technical support to sub-contracts and manufacturing interfaces.
Collaborating closely with Systems, Test, and Electronics engineers to solve integration problems on advanced systems.

Job Requirements:

Experience in the following areas is highly desirable:

Microwave PCB materials and design techniques
RF Microwave Sub-System Design
Microwave design tools such as AWR, VSS, ADS, Systemvue, and Matlab
EM 3D and 2D simulation techniques, e.g. CST
GaAs/GaN MMIC design and application
RF Synthesiser design using DDS and PLL technologies
RF downconverter and digitiser design
Design of passive microwave structures
Low phase noise design and measurement
Non-linear circuit simulation
PCB schematic capture tools, e.g. Mentor
Lab measurements including signal generation, spectrum analysis, and vector network analysis
Microwave component selection
Requirements capture and management
Technical report writing, design reviews, and lifecycle management
Design for manufacture and cost
